The PT PMA structure behind the rice farming project

Foreign ownership of the rice farming project follows the exact commercial activity, not the agricultural label alone. Under Presidential Regulation No. 49 of 2021 , commercial fields are generally open unless closed, reserved or conditioned, so the rice farming project shareholder paper must screen 01121 / 01122 and every additional revenue line. If processing, trading or a fee service sits beside rice farming, that neighbouring activity needs its own conclusion.

The Indonesian PT PMA should control the farm manager, agronomist, field supervisors and seasonal labour, material contracts, site rights and customer receipts for the rice farming project. A foreign corporate shareholder for the rice farming project must connect its registry record and board authority to the deed signatory. The rice farming project conclusion for 01121 / 01122 should then match beneficial-owner, tax, OSS and bank records.

Land and location conditions for the rice farming project

A lawful rice farming project site needs verified ownership or lessor authority, boundaries, access and spatial compatibility. Read the proposed rice farming right or lease against Government Regulation No. 18 of 2021 ; the rice farming project plan should not assume personal foreign ownership of Indonesian freehold land. The rice farming project land instrument must support the same 01121 / 01122 location entered in OSS.

Legal title does not prove that the rice farming project will work. The technical review should address Irrigation allocation, paddy-field spatial protection and planting-season water access must survive site due diligence. Parcel observations, seasonal evidence and utility tests belong in the decision file for this rice farming operation. A regional description supplied by the rice farming project land seller cannot replace that site evidence.

Environmental obligations for the rice farming project depend on capacity, process, impact and place under Government Regulation No. 22 of 2021 . Use a conditional lease, option or staged payment while material rice farming project questions at the 01121 / 01122 location remain open. For this rice farming location, that structure preserves an exit when OSS, spatial or environmental evidence fails to align.

From NIB to an effective rice farming project licence path

The NIB identifies the rice farming project, but it is not blanket authority for every 01121 / 01122 operation. Under Government Regulation No. 28 of 2025 , the live rice farming project OSS output may add verification, a Standard Certificate, a licence or PB UMKU. The PT PMA can begin only rice farming work supported by effective outputs at its filed location.

The agriculture layer for this rice farming project is also fact-specific: Seed activity, plant-protection products and post-harvest handling can trigger requirements beyond crop cultivation. Compare the portal result with Agriculture Ministry Regulation No. 15 of 2021 and any current product, plant-health, animal-health, seed or facility rule triggered by rice farming. A submission receipt should remain separate from issued and verified authority.

The rice farming project permission register should name the trigger, issuer, prerequisite, status, evidence and renewal owner. Reconcile the rice farming project register with the deed, 01121 / 01122, land file and environmental path before its first invoice. Any mismatched rice farming capacity or address should stop the affected activity until corrected.

Budget the full cash cycle for the rice farming project

The rice farming project budget needs separate lines for formation expenses, shareholder capital, project assets and operating cash. Under BKPM Regulation No. 5 of 2025 , the general rice farming project PT PMA plan commonly starts with at least IDR 2.5 billion of issued and paid-up capital, unless a sector rule requires more. That corporate funding is not a registration-provider fee.

The broader rice farming project investment plan is usually assessed separately and commonly exceeds IDR 10 billion for each business field and project location, subject to applicable calculation rules. For this 01121 / 01122 project, Land preparation, irrigation rehabilitation, seed, fertiliser, drying losses and working capital across each harvest cycle drive the project budget. Those rice farming facts determine the cash needed through the planting-to-harvest cycle.

A defensible operating model for the rice farming project compares validation, operating and scale cases. Recalculate the rice farming runway for a 20% launch delay, 15% lower output or utilisation and a 10% increase in its largest variable cost. The rice farming project board can then set its cash buffer and an evidence-based expansion date.

The critical path for launching the rice farming project

The critical path for the rice farming project begins with complete ownership, activity and document instructions. Current 2026 market references place straightforward rice farming corporate work around 10–20 business days and sector approvals around 14–60 business days. The rice farming project site, environmental and technical work for 01121 / 01122 determines whether tasks can run in parallel.

For planning, a clean rice farming project case is about 35–70 business days from accepted instructions to a defined operating gate. A normal single-site rice farming case is about 70–130 business days, while corrected documents, site redesign or complex verification can require 130–220 business days. These rice farming ranges are market-planning references checked on August 17, 2026, not official guarantees.

The rice farming project launch should follow irreversible commitments. For rice farming, incorporation, tax activation and NIB issuance precede effective sector conditions, site commissioning and the first lawful sale. The biological or service schedule for rice farming should not outrun approvals that cannot be repaired after inputs, animals or customer obligations are committed.
